Fight over Arctic wildlife refuge heats up

 From the Washington Post:

The coastal plain - believed to contain an estimated 11 billion barrels of recoverable oil - has been a battleground for decades between environmentalists who don't want drilling and oil companies and Alaska officials that see a large, untapped resource that could ease the country's dependence on foreign oil.
